Community Food Hubs

Affordable food, support and advice open to all. No referral needed.

Get the support you need whilst helping to fight food waste at our Community Food Hubs. Access affordable food, learn low-cost cooking, and find support on a range of social issues. Just bring a bag and a suggested donation of £5*. No one will be turned away.

How it works

Bring a shopping bag and fill it from a selection of mixed groceries and rescued produce for a suggested donation of £5, helping you to save your money for other essentials. The food you choose from the community food hub will not only help you but because the food is rescued it is good for the planet too.

Our friendly staff and volunteers will be on hand to help you make the most of your weekly shop by sharing recipes, healthy options, cookery skills, and tips to reduce your household food waste. We will host regular cooking demonstrations and include our favourite food-saving tips.

We work closely with local organisations, charities and community groups and will help connect you to the long-term support you might require. We will have information available on local support groups and often invite these groups in so you can meet them whilst you wait.

Who is it for?

We encourage anyone who is on a tight budget, for any reason, to come along and get the support you need. You do not need a referral, no one will be turned away, and you are not limited on the amount of times you can come.

WSCC Waste and Recycling Team have partnered with us to support seven monthly Community Food Hubs all across West Sussex, in addition to the ones within Chichester District. The Community Food Hubs are open to everyone and are designed to reduce food waste. Simply bring a shopping bag and ­fill it from a selection of mixed groceries for a suggested donation of £3.50. These are confirmed to run until April 2025.
